All JOLT Challenge Coaches are fully trained, credentialed ICF (International Coach Federation) coaches, hand picked by the Mind Warriors team for their expertise and experience. All Coaches have experienced the 9-week JOLT Challenge program and run their own successful coaching business.
There are many people these days who claim to be ‘coaches’. However, not all coaches are created equal. Having a coach who has been credentialed by the ICF means that the JOLT Challenge coaches:
- Have received professional training from a programme specifically designed to teach coaching skills in alignment with the ICF competencies and Code of Ethics
- Have demonstrated a proficient understanding and use of the coaching competencies as outlined by the ICF
- Are accountable to the ethics and standards promoted by the ICF.
The Coaching Package
The package consists of 4 hours per participant. The hours can be divided into 4 x 1 hour sessions, 8 x 30min sessions or at a time allocation that works best for the participant.
Prior to the commencement of the JOLT Challenge program participants will be required to select a coach, make contact and set up appointment times. The coaching is done by phone or over Skype. Four of these coaching sessions must coincide with the JOLT Challenge measurement program – at the end of weeks 3, 7, 9, and 4 weeks post program.
